通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何关闭python整蛊程序

如何关闭python整蛊程序

要关闭Python整蛊程序,可以通过以下几种方法:使用任务管理器或活动监视器、利用命令行终止进程、使用Python代码强制终止程序。其中,使用任务管理器或活动监视器是最常见和直接的方法。通过打开任务管理器(Windows)或活动监视器(Mac),找到并结束对应的Python进程,便可立即停止整蛊程序的运行。以下将详细描述如何使用任务管理器关闭Python程序。

一、使用任务管理器或活动监视器

在Windows系统上:

  1. 打开任务管理器

    • 按下Ctrl + Shift + Esc组合键,或者右键点击任务栏选择“任务管理器”。
  2. 找到Python进程

    • 在任务管理器窗口中,切换到“进程”标签页,找到名为“python.exe”或“pythonw.exe”的进程。通常整蛊程序会以这些名称运行。
  3. 结束进程

    • 选中对应的Python进程,点击“结束任务”按钮。这样可以强制停止该Python程序的运行。

在Mac系统上:

  1. 打开活动监视器

    • 可以通过“应用程序” > “实用工具” > “活动监视器”来打开,或者使用Spotlight搜索“活动监视器”。
  2. 找到Python进程

    • 在活动监视器窗口中,切换到“CPU”标签页,找到名为“python”或“python3”的进程。
  3. 结束进程

    • 选中对应的Python进程,点击左上角的“×”按钮,然后选择“强制退出”。这样可以强制停止该Python程序的运行。

二、利用命令行终止进程

在Windows系统上:

  1. 打开命令提示符

    • 按下Win + R组合键,输入cmd并按回车键。
  2. 查找Python进程的PID

    • 输入tasklist | findstr python来查找所有正在运行的Python进程及其PID(进程标识符)。
  3. 结束Python进程

    • 使用taskkill /PID <PID号> /F命令来结束对应的Python进程。需要将<PID号>替换为实际的进程标识符。

在Mac系统上:

  1. 打开终端

    • 可以通过“应用程序” > “实用工具” > “终端”来打开,或者使用Spotlight搜索“终端”。
  2. 查找Python进程的PID

    • 输入ps aux | grep python来查找所有正在运行的Python进程及其PID(进程标识符)。
  3. 结束Python进程

    • 使用kill -9 <PID号>命令来结束对应的Python进程。需要将<PID号>替换为实际的进程标识符。

三、使用Python代码强制终止程序

有时,您可能希望在Python代码内部实现对自身或其他Python进程的强制终止。以下是一些相关的方法:

使用os._exit()函数

import os

执行一些操作

强制终止程序

os._exit(0)

使用sys.exit()函数

import sys

执行一些操作

终止程序并返回一个退出状态码

sys.exit(0)

使用signal模块

import signal

import os

获取当前进程ID

pid = os.getpid()

发送信号终止程序

os.kill(pid, signal.SIGTERM)

这些方法可以在代码内部调用,达到强制终止程序的效果。

四、预防和检测整蛊程序

安装和使用防病毒软件

防病毒软件可以帮助检测和删除恶意程序,包括整蛊程序。建议安装并定期更新防病毒软件,进行全盘扫描以确保系统安全。

监控系统进程

定期检查系统中运行的进程,特别是那些不熟悉或可疑的进程。如果发现可疑进程,可以进一步调查其来源,并采取相应措施进行处理。

限制未知程序的运行

通过设置系统权限和用户账户控制,限制未知程序的运行。确保只运行来自可信来源的程序,避免下载和运行可疑软件。

使用虚拟机或沙盒环境

在测试或运行不确定程序时,可以使用虚拟机或沙盒环境。这样可以隔离系统主环境,避免潜在的风险和损害。

五、总结

关闭Python整蛊程序的方法包括使用任务管理器或活动监视器、利用命令行终止进程、以及使用Python代码强制终止程序。在实际操作中,建议根据具体情况选择最适合的方法。此外,为了预防和检测整蛊程序,安装防病毒软件、监控系统进程、限制未知程序的运行、以及使用虚拟机或沙盒环境都是有效的措施。通过这些方法,可以有效保护系统的安全和稳定运行。

相关问答FAQs:

如何识别和关闭潜在的Python整蛊程序?
在使用Python编写的整蛊程序时,识别其特征非常重要。通常,这些程序会在系统中运行一些不寻常的操作,例如不断弹出窗口或占用过多资源。可以通过任务管理器查看正在运行的进程,识别出可疑的Python进程,并通过结束任务来关闭它们。

关闭整蛊程序后,如何确保系统安全?
关闭整蛊程序后,建议对系统进行全面扫描,以确保没有其他恶意软件潜伏在后台。使用可信的反病毒软件进行扫描,并定期更新病毒库,确保能够识别最新的威胁。此外,备份重要文件也是一个很好的保护措施,以防数据丢失。

如果整蛊程序无法正常关闭,我该怎么办?
在遇到无法关闭的整蛊程序时,可以考虑重启计算机进入安全模式。在安全模式下,许多不必要的程序不会启动,这使得关闭整蛊程序变得更加容易。还可以尝试使用命令行工具,如“taskkill”命令,强制结束可疑的Python进程。如果问题依然存在,考虑寻求专业的技术支持。

相关文章